🔥 Bass Legend Marco Mendoza on the dopeYEAH talk Podcast! 🎸🎵What does it take to spend four decades holding down the low end for some of rock's most iconic bands — Thin Lizzy, Whitesnake, The Dead Daisies, and Ted Nugent — and still sound hungry for the next show? 🎸🔥 In this episode, Rob Cass sits down with Marco Mendoza, the bassist, singer, and song producer whose resume reads like a history of modern rock music.Marco takes us back to San Diego, where jazz and big band records shaped his ear long before rock took over. He talks candidly about being married at sixteen and playing gigs while quietly hiding an addiction — one of the more honest musician stories you'll hear on this podcast — before hitting rock bottom and finding his way to 38 years of sobriety. 🎶 He remembers the call that changed everything: "Darling, Marco, this is David Coverdale," the moment that pulled him into Whitesnake and into a different level of the business.From there, the stories keep coming — joining Black Star Riders, trading riffs with iconic guitarists like Steve Vai, and building a reputation as one of rock's great bass slappers along the way. 🎤 Marco talks about the industry interviews he's given over the years, what it's like sharing a stage with guitar legends across generations of rock music culture, and why he still geeks out over a great groove.
